Brigade Enterprises' Hyderabad Venture: A Blueprint for Developers

Market Signal: Why This Hyderabad Project Matters

Brigade Enterprises' announcement of a 5.6-acre housing project in Hyderabad, projected to yield Rs 850 crore in revenue, is more than just a single developer's expansion. It's a strong indicator of institutional capital flowing into Hyderabad's residential segment, signaling robust demand and a positive outlook for the region. For other developers and landowners, this move validates Hyderabad as a prime investment destination, particularly in its western corridors.

The sheer scale of the revenue projection suggests a focus on mid-to-premium housing, catering to the city's burgeoning IT and service sector workforce. This implies a potential supply-demand mismatch that developers who can deliver quality projects quickly can capitalize on. Landowners in or near established and emerging growth corridors should view this as an opportune moment to explore development partnerships or sales.

Location-Specific Opportunities: Gachibowli, Kokapet, and the Financial District

While the specific location within Hyderabad hasn't been detailed, Brigade's typical project profiles suggest a strong likelihood of development within or adjacent to the city's tech hubs. Areas like Gachibowli, Kokapet, and the burgeoning Financial District are prime candidates. These micro-markets benefit from established social infrastructure, excellent connectivity, and a consistent influx of high-earning professionals seeking quality housing.

The continued growth of IT and BFSI sectors in these zones creates sustained demand for residential spaces. Developers with land parcels or existing assets in these areas have a unique advantage. However, competition is also intensifying, making differentiated offerings and superior amenity packages key to capturing market share. Understanding the specific buyer profile in each of these sub-markets will be crucial for tailoring project designs and marketing strategies.
